Shelley Osterloh reporting Police are searching for a man who robbed a Mountain America Credit Union on 12th South and Redwood Road.

This robbery could have been deadly because some people who saw the suspect, chased the guy for a while until he started shooting at them.

About ten this morning a robber walked into this Mountain America Credit Union demanding money.

Road construction workers saw the suspect go in said he looked like a tall thin black business man.

But as soon as he got in the bank, he put on a mask of a president, and pulled out a gun.

Det. Dwayne Baird, Salt Lake City Police: " HE WAS WEARING A CAUCASIAN TYPE HALLOWEEN STYLE MASK HAD A GUN OUT AS SOON AS HE CAME INTO THE BANK POINTED THE GUN AT THE EMPLOYEES OF THE BANK, AND AS HE WALKED UP HE WAS DEMANDING MONEY. "

Brigham Barlow, chased suspect: “THE LADIES COME RUNNING OUT OF THE BANK, PRETTY EXCITED SO WE TOOK OFF AFTER HIM, GOT TO HIM... GOT TO HIS CAR... I WAS ABOUT TO JUMP ON HIS CAR AND HE KIND OF WENT LIKE THIS.... DIDN'T SEE IF HE HAD GUN OR NOT, BUT HE KIND OF WENT LIKE THIS... SO I JUST GOT HIS LICENSE NUMBER AND BACKED OFF”

A Utah Department of Transportation inspector was in his truck as the suspect's dark Nissan Maxima sped out of the parking lot, so he followed for a few blocks into a nearby neighborhood where the suspect fired shots at him --- one striking right near his head just behind the side window.

That's when he stopped chasing the suspect.

Police are looking for a newer dark red or brown Nissan Maxima with stolen license plates: 817 MEN.

The suspect is described as tall -- 6- foot to 6' 3" --thin, African American, with very short hair, maybe bald.

Police say this robbery is not connected to another bank robbery this afternoon --- that one at a Wells Fargo on Foothill Blvd.
